There are both outpatient and inpatient drug treatment, but there are a few sub-categories of outpatient drug and alcohol rehab in Winfield to choose from. Typical outpatient treatment is not invasive and clients usually participate in therapy and counseling a few times a week. Comprehensive outpatient rehabs provide counseling and therapy similar to normal outpatient, but on a more intensive pace which also accommodates work and family life.
One outpatient drug rehab option referred to as Day Treatment or Partial Hospitalization is the most intensive form of outpatient rehab out there. Clients can still go to a sober-living program or home at the end of each day, but will spend the majority of their time participating in outpatient treatment services. Day treatment and partial hospitalization outpatient drug or alcohol treatment is ideal for individuals who have recently finished an inpatient program, but still need to keep a strong support system while becoming more confident about a sober lifestyle. These rehabs also tend to offer a wider spectrum of care that regular outpatient may not offer, including alternative therapies, medication management, and dual-diagnosis treatment.
It is common for individuals in outpatient drug rehab or after rehab in outpatient alcohol or drug rehab to have a relapse. In these cases inpatient treatment would ideally be the next step.
